(01-06-2023, 08:12 AM)The Real Marty Wrote:(01-06-2023, 08:01 AM)MarleyJag Wrote: With shade, a 60K capacity and an extended stretch of winning, expect a looooong season ticket waiting list which is what they want and is a good thing. Wonder how this will play into the city's plan for the future of the Florida/Georgia game? Many franchises with rightly sized stadiums relative to their market have waiting lists. Even the Jags had one coming off the 2007 season. The number of people who can afford them will exceed the available supply of tickets unless you charge so much that there's just a huge drop off and only a tiny percentage can buy them. Having a waiting list is actually beneficial to the team because it decreases the sensitivity to price changes (within reason) and people are much more likely to keep their season tickets year over year.
